irpas技术客

初识c语言系列-1-第一个c语言程序_月亮嚼成星~_第一个c语言程序

大大的周 1327

目录 1、==该系列的介绍==2、==未来的打算==3、==简单介绍c语言==4、==第一个c语言程序==

1、该系列的介绍

首先呢,开始这个系列之前呢,先简简单单对该系列做个介绍。我是一个小白,对于计算机编程有很多不懂之处,所以可能有一些不足之处,希望大家帮忙指出,我们一起进步。这个系列是对c语言快速的过一边,内容不是特别详细,也不要求别的和我一样的小白完全掌握,就是咱们一起了解一下c语言的内容,后续大概率我会再出详细的教程介绍c语言,欢迎一起来学习啦!

2、未来的打算

先打算把这个系列更完,应该也不是太多,毕竟只是先大致的了解一下c语言,后续可能会出初阶和进阶教程,希望喜欢的朋友们可以期待一波,顺便动动你们的小手,多多支持一下可怜的娃。

3、简单介绍c语言

那么接下来咱就言归正传了哈。(你在期待什么? )说到这个c语言啊,咱就不得不提提他的大哥B语言了,哦,算了串台了,不好意思哈。c语言是一种计算机语言,还有你们熟悉的Java,c++,python等等都是计算机语言。人与人之间交流需要语言,那么人与计算机交流同样需要语言来充当桥梁(不然你们相互听不懂,人家骂你你都不知道哈哈哈) 最初的计算机语言是比较落后的,发展如该链图。

#mermaid-svg-5RqwCIBNQG8Lsxlt {font-family:"trebuchet ms",verdana,arial,sans-serif;font-size:16px;fill:#333;}#mermaid-svg-5RqwCIBNQG8Lsxlt .error-icon{fill:#552222;}#mermaid-svg-5RqwCIBNQG8Lsxlt .error-text{fill:#552222;stroke:#552222;}#mermaid-svg-5RqwCIBNQG8Lsxlt .edge-thickness-normal{stroke-width:2px;}#mermaid-svg-5RqwCIBNQG8Lsxlt .edge-thickness-thick{stroke-width:3.5px;}#mermaid-svg-5RqwCIBNQG8Lsxlt .edge-pattern-solid{stroke-dasharray:0;}#mermaid-svg-5RqwCIBNQG8Lsxlt .edge-pattern-dashed{stroke-dasharray:3;}#mermaid-svg-5RqwCIBNQG8Lsxlt .edge-pattern-dotted{stroke-dasharray:2;}#mermaid-svg-5RqwCIBNQG8Lsxlt .marker{fill:#333333;stroke:#333333;}#mermaid-svg-5RqwCIBNQG8Lsxlt .marker.cross{stroke:#333333;}#mermaid-svg-5RqwCIBNQG8Lsxlt svg{font-family:"trebuchet ms",verdana,arial,sans-serif;font-size:16px;}#mermaid-svg-5RqwCIBNQG8Lsxlt .label{font-family:"trebuchet ms",verdana,arial,sans-serif;color:#333;}#mermaid-svg-5RqwCIBNQG8Lsxlt .cluster-label text{fill:#333;}#mermaid-svg-5RqwCIBNQG8Lsxlt .cluster-label span{color:#333;}#mermaid-svg-5RqwCIBNQG8Lsxlt .label text,#mermaid-svg-5RqwCIBNQG8Lsxlt span{fill:#333;color:#333;}#mermaid-svg-5RqwCIBNQG8Lsxlt .node rect,#mermaid-svg-5RqwCIBNQG8Lsxlt .node circle,#mermaid-svg-5RqwCIBNQG8Lsxlt .node ellipse,#mermaid-svg-5RqwCIBNQG8Lsxlt .node polygon,#mermaid-svg-5RqwCIBNQG8Lsxlt .node path{fill:#ECECFF;stroke:#9370DB;stroke-width:1px;}#mermaid-svg-5RqwCIBNQG8Lsxlt .node .label{text-align:center;}#mermaid-svg-5RqwCIBNQG8Lsxlt .node.clickable{cursor:pointer;}#mermaid-svg-5RqwCIBNQG8Lsxlt .arrowheadPath{fill:#333333;}#mermaid-svg-5RqwCIBNQG8Lsxlt .edgePath .path{stroke:#333333;stroke-width:2.0px;}#mermaid-svg-5RqwCIBNQG8Lsxlt .flowchart-link{stroke:#333333;fill:none;}#mermaid-svg-5RqwCIBNQG8Lsxlt .edgeLabel{background-color:#e8e8e8;text-align:center;}#mermaid-svg-5RqwCIBNQG8Lsxlt .edgeLabel rect{opacity:0.5;background-color:#e8e8e8;fill:#e8e8e8;}#mermaid-svg-5RqwCIBNQG8Lsxlt .cluster rect{fill:#ffffde;stroke:#aaaa33;stroke-width:1px;}#mermaid-svg-5RqwCIBNQG8Lsxlt .cluster text{fill:#333;}#mermaid-svg-5RqwCIBNQG8Lsxlt .cluster span{color:#333;}#mermaid-svg-5RqwCIBNQG8Lsxlt div.mermaidTooltip{position:absolute;text-align:center;max-width:200px;padding:2px;font-family:"trebuchet ms",verdana,arial,sans-serif;font-size:12px;background:hsl(80, 100%, 96.2745098039%);border:1px solid #aaaa33;border-radius:2px;pointer-events:none;z-index:100;}#mermaid-svg-5RqwCIBNQG8Lsxlt :root{--mermaid-font-family:"trebuchet ms",verdana,arial,sans-serif;} 二进制指令 汇编指令 B语言 C语言

计算机语言的发展历程是比较艰辛的,在C语言前的都是低级语言,到了C语言就变成了高级语言,后面又出现了许许多多的编程语言。那么下面我们要了解一下编译器的运行过程

#mermaid-svg-CqgzUrP9wkzL93dn {font-family:"trebuchet ms",verdana,arial,sans-serif;font-size:16px;fill:#333;}#mermaid-svg-CqgzUrP9wkzL93dn .error-icon{fill:#552222;}#mermaid-svg-CqgzUrP9wkzL93dn .error-text{fill:#552222;stroke:#552222;}#mermaid-svg-CqgzUrP9wkzL93dn .edge-thickness-normal{stroke-width:2px;}#mermaid-svg-CqgzUrP9wkzL93dn .edge-thickness-thick{stroke-width:3.5px;}#mermaid-svg-CqgzUrP9wkzL93dn .edge-pattern-solid{stroke-dasharray:0;}#mermaid-svg-CqgzUrP9wkzL93dn .edge-pattern-dashed{stroke-dasharray:3;}#mermaid-svg-CqgzUrP9wkzL93dn .edge-pattern-dotted{stroke-dasharray:2;}#mermaid-svg-CqgzUrP9wkzL93dn .marker{fill:#333333;stroke:#333333;}#mermaid-svg-CqgzUrP9wkzL93dn .marker.cross{stroke:#333333;}#mermaid-svg-CqgzUrP9wkzL93dn svg{font-family:"trebuchet ms",verdana,arial,sans-serif;font-size:16px;}#mermaid-svg-CqgzUrP9wkzL93dn .label{font-family:"trebuchet ms",verdana,arial,sans-serif;color:#333;}#mermaid-svg-CqgzUrP9wkzL93dn .cluster-label text{fill:#333;}#mermaid-svg-CqgzUrP9wkzL93dn .cluster-label span{color:#333;}#mermaid-svg-CqgzUrP9wkzL93dn .label text,#mermaid-svg-CqgzUrP9wkzL93dn span{fill:#333;color:#333;}#mermaid-svg-CqgzUrP9wkzL93dn .node rect,#mermaid-svg-CqgzUrP9wkzL93dn .node circle,#mermaid-svg-CqgzUrP9wkzL93dn .node ellipse,#mermaid-svg-CqgzUrP9wkzL93dn .node polygon,#mermaid-svg-CqgzUrP9wkzL93dn .node path{fill:#ECECFF;stroke:#9370DB;stroke-width:1px;}#mermaid-svg-CqgzUrP9wkzL93dn .node .label{text-align:center;}#mermaid-svg-CqgzUrP9wkzL93dn .node.clickable{cursor:pointer;}#mermaid-svg-CqgzUrP9wkzL93dn .arrowheadPath{fill:#333333;}#mermaid-svg-CqgzUrP9wkzL93dn .edgePath .path{stroke:#333333;stroke-width:2.0px;}#mermaid-svg-CqgzUrP9wkzL93dn .flowchart-link{stroke:#333333;fill:none;}#mermaid-svg-CqgzUrP9wkzL93dn .edgeLabel{background-color:#e8e8e8;text-align:center;}#mermaid-svg-CqgzUrP9wkzL93dn .edgeLabel rect{opacity:0.5;background-color:#e8e8e8;fill:#e8e8e8;}#mermaid-svg-CqgzUrP9wkzL93dn .cluster rect{fill:#ffffde;stroke:#aaaa33;stroke-width:1px;}#mermaid-svg-CqgzUrP9wkzL93dn .cluster text{fill:#333;}#mermaid-svg-CqgzUrP9wkzL93dn .cluster span{color:#333;}#mermaid-svg-CqgzUrP9wkzL93dn div.mermaidTooltip{position:absolute;text-align:center;max-width:200px;padding:2px;font-family:"trebuchet ms",verdana,arial,sans-serif;font-size:12px;background:hsl(80, 100%, 96.2745098039%);border:1px solid #aaaa33;border-radius:2px;pointer-events:none;z-index:100;}#mermaid-svg-CqgzUrP9wkzL93dn :root{--mermaid-font-family:"trebuchet ms",verdana,arial,sans-serif;} 预处理 编译 汇编 链接

我们现在只需要了解个大概就OK 总而言之,C语言是一种计算机语言,是我们与计算机交流的媒介,学会了它就学会了与计算机沟通交流了,那么你们不激动吗?(从入门到入土哈哈哈)

4、第一个c语言程序

那么接下来就让我们写出第一个C语言程序吧!

#include<stdio.h> int main() { printf("Hello CSDN!"); return 0; }

首先打开vs2019(作者用的2019) 打开后是这个界面,点击红框部分 之后点击创建新项目,然后下一步 为你的项目起个名字,并选择路径,之后点击创建! 创建完成右击源文件选择添加->新建项 然后会弹出以下界面 最后点击添加就可以写你的第一个c语言程序啦!

所用的标点符号必须是英文符号,否则计算机无法识别!!!

stdio.h中std表示的是英语"标准"的简写,i相当于input,o相当于output,这两个表示输入输出流。另外,一个程序中有且只有一个main函数,你可以理解成一个孩子有且只有一个爸爸(这里说的是亲爸爸)printf函数是经常用到的输出函数,还有输入函数scanf,需要的时候会再给大家说,接下里我们运行一下这个程序:

呐,运行结果就出来了,它就在这么一个小框框里面,你可以去试试啦! 对,指的就是你,只看不练,怎么能会呢 如果有什么问题请在评论区指出哦!我们一起进步


1.本站遵循行业规范,任何转载的稿件都会明确标注作者和来源;2.本站的原创文章,会注明原创字样,如未注明都非原创,如有侵权请联系删除!;3.作者投稿可能会经我们编辑修改或补充;4.本站不提供任何储存功能只提供收集或者投稿人的网盘链接。

标签: #第一个C语言程序